(Page 2) <br />MINE ID # OR PROSPECTING ID # M-1982-033 <br />INSPECTION DATE 3/31/09 <br />INSPECTOR'S INITIALS WHE <br />OBSERVATIONS <br />This inspection occurred as part of the Division review process for an application to transfer the permit from Malouff <br />Construction to Absmeier Landscaping and Construction (SO-01). The Malouff Pit is approved for 90 acres <br />affected lands. Affected lands will be reclaimed to support general agriculture post-mining land use. The Division <br />holds $1,714 financial warranty. The appropriate amount of financial warranty for this site is $4,035. <br />Based on observations recorded during the September 26, 2007 site inspection, on January 22, 2008 the Division <br />estimated the cost of reclamation at $4,035. On February 5, 2008, the Division provided notice to increase the <br />financial warranty from $1,714 to $4,035. The increase in financial warranty was not received by the 60-day <br />deadline provided by Rule 4.2.1(2) and the Division scheduled the matter for consideration by the Mined Land <br />Reclamation Board for possible violation. The Board considered the issue during a January 7, 2009 hearing and <br />found Malouff Construction in violation of Sections 34-32.5-117(4)(b)(1), for failure to maintain sufficient financial <br />warranty to assure the completion of reclamation, and 34-32.5-117(4)(c)(II), C.R.S., for failure to submit a financial <br />warranty within 60 days of the adjustment. The Board assessed a civil penalty of $4,139.84 and ordered Malouff <br />Construction to provide the $4,035 financial warranty and civil penalty by February 22, 2009. Division records do <br />not indicate that Malouff Construction has submitted the $4,139.84 civil penalty or posted the increased financial. <br />warranty in the amount of $4,035. Copy of the Board's Order is enclosed. <br />On March 13, 2009, Absmeier submitted an application to transfer the permit and become successor operator. <br />Prior to approving the transfer of permit, the Division must receive appropriately executed financial and performance <br />warranties. During this March 31, 2009 site inspection, the condition of the site appeared similar to those observed <br />during the September 26, 2007 inspection. Therefore, the Division has determined the reclamation cost estimation <br />totaling $4,035 to be current for the purposes of SO-01. Should Absmeier desire to become the operator of the <br />permit, M-1982-033, please submit financial warranty in the amount of $4,035, and an appropriately executed <br />performance warranty. Once the Division has fully approved the performance and financial warranties the permit <br />transfer may be approved. <br />The existing reclamation plan indicates that the pit floor will be stabilized with gravel surface but does not address <br />how the operator will stabilize the 3H:1 V slopes. Therefore, the Division strongly encourages the operator to revise <br />the reclamation plan to address stabilization of the 3H:1 V slopes.
